80% post consumer recycled content means that 80% by weight of the raw material going into the pulping process is recycled paper that was used for something else previously (most likely newsprint, printer paper, or cardboard) The pulping process treats it in order to make the fibers more pliable and of course remove inks, coatings, and bleaches it. The pulp then goes into a paper machine where it's turned into toilet paper. The main benefit of recycled paper is not actually eliminating the paper waste IMO. wood fibers decay naturally and plain paper is 100% biodegradable, what is not biodegradable is the inks and coatings applied to the paper during the manufacturing process, recycling captures these chemicals in the waste stream of the pulping process which does have to be disposed of properly due to environmental regulations. A fun little sourdough tip: once your starter is mature, spread some of your discard starter on a tray lined with parchment and allow it to dry out at room temperature until it is completely dry. It will take at least a couple of days. Blend it into a powder and store just incase you somehow kill your starter. To use it you would add some to flour and water as you would if you were starting a new starter, but you don’t have to start from scratch. Be careful with some of the chicken feeds. Some of the natural organic feeds (we used to get scratch and peck) are not pasteurized, like your generic purina feed. Perfectly fine, honestly its amazing feed - but do not get it wet! It will grow mold. We got a bag of feed that somehow had gotten wet but didn't even think it was a big deal and poured it into our metal trash can that we keep our chicken food in. We continually dumped more feed on top of that and eventually it grew mold and killed about 3/4 of our flock.
